District pilots new science and Spanish curricula; adoption proposal expected in spring
Summary
The district is piloting new science curriculum material and a Spanish curriculum; science committee met March 16 and a formal proposal is expected in April or May to align with Illinois standards.

Jolene Miller reported that the district's science committee met virtually on March 16 to evaluate pilot curriculum materials; staff hope to bring a full proposal in April or May for board consideration. Social-studies teams are reviewing materials for alignment with Illinois standards, and Mr. Menshing has been piloting a new Spanish curriculum slated for implementation next school year.
The district will continue classroom piloting and standards review before any formal adoption or purchase requests reach the board.
